According to a recent LinkedIn post from Turbine Finance Corp, co‑founder and CEO Mike Hurst is scheduled to speak on the Investor All‑Stars panel at Finovate Spring 2026 in San Diego on Thursday, May 7 at 3:10 p.m. The panel is set to include representatives from Symphonic Capital, American Family Ventures, and Blueprint Equity, moderated by Finovate’s David Penn.

The company’s LinkedIn post highlights that the discussion will focus on industry issues such as funding levels, valuations, and liquidity. For investors, this visibility at a prominent fintech conference may signal Turbine Finance’s engagement with key capital providers and thought leaders, potentially supporting networking, deal flow opportunities, and insight into current market sentiment around fintech financing.
The post also indicates an interest in connecting with attendees at Finovate Spring, which could facilitate strategic relationships or partnerships. While no concrete business developments are detailed, the firm’s participation on a high‑profile investor panel may enhance brand recognition and position Turbine Finance more prominently within the fintech investment ecosystem.
